Punteggio 18/20 · Da bere 2023-2033, Julia Harding MW, jancisrobinson.com, Apr 2023

AP number 18 19. From volcanic soils close to the Nahe. Spontaneous-fermentation-derived herbal notes but also very smoky/mineral and stony. That pepperiness gives the impression there is a little bit of CO 2 , but I don't think there is. Intensely salty and mouth-watering finish. (JH)

Punteggio 92/100 · Da bere 2020-2028, David Schildknecht, Vinous, Jun 2020

Pungent scents of juniper berry and huckleberry anticipate the pith and piquancy exhibited on a firm palate. Sage and struck flint heighten the pungency, revealing a reductive tendency familiar from most Schäfer-Fröhlich Rieslings, one that thankfully translates into productive tension on a sappy, subtly resinous midpalate and a vibrantly gripping finish. Look for this to significantly evolve in bottle, hopefully acquiring more generous juiciness as well as textural polish without sacrificing its impressive sense of energy. Felsenberg tends to demand early picking, but Fröhlich said that this year he was able to postpone harvest in certain parcels so as to end up with a more complex whole than might otherwise have been possible.

Punteggio 95/100 · Da bere 2024-2038, Stephan Reinhardt, Wine Advocate, Oct 2019

The 2018 Felsenberg Riesling GG opens with a deep, intense and rich, concentrated and aromatic but also flinty bouquet full of ripe Riesling fruits and coolish herbal/vegetal as well gooseberry aromas. On the palate, this is a lush, intense, very mineral, salty-piquant and tightly structured dry Riesling from volcanic rocks. It's a powerful but elegant, fresh and precise Riesling with great complexity and lingering salinity. A fabulous Felsenberg with lots of vitality and youthful grip. 13% alcohol. Natural cork. Tasted in August and October 2019.

Punteggio 96/100 · James Suckling, Sep 2019

From a very stony and steep site, this has elegance and purity with gently creamy notes, as well as a flinty edge. Pithy, dried lemon and grapefruit, too. The palate has a very pure and assertive feel with fresh and powerful fruit that is very much dialed into the mineral zone. Super salty finish. Drink or hold.
